Harry Plantinga) writes: >I know that you are supposed to have 1 Mb memory to use hypercard, but >heck, with all the hype I can't restrain my technolust. Can you use >hypercard at all on a mac 512KE? Has anyone tried it? No, I'd be willing to bet that you can't. Here is one of my experiences: I have a Mac+ running MacServe with SuperLaserSpool running on it. Both of these take memory and because of these (especially the laser spooler) I cannot run HyperCard in full mode, I can only go 1 past browse. I'd be willing to bet that 512K is not even close enough. Herb Barad [USC - Signal and Image Processing Institute] email: barad@brand.usc.edu or ...!sdcrdcf!oberon!brand!barad
